Teoman Duralı (Şaban Teoman Duralı) is a Turkish philosopher known for his original contributions in the history of philosophy, philosophy of science, and philosophy of biology. Born on 7 February 1947 in the Kozlu district of Zonguldak, Duralı taught at various universities throughout his academic career, most notably at Istanbul University, where he conducted some of the earliest work in the philosophy of biology in Türkiye.
